The Oklahoma City Ballet, founded in 1972, has been the crown jewel of the city’s performing arts scene for almost 50 years. With a repertoire that ranges from classical to contemporary, there’s something for everyone to enjoy. Whether you’re a fan of Tchaikovsky or Taylor Swift, you’ll find a performance that suits your taste. And let’s not forget the annual holiday favorite, The Nutcracker, which has become a beloved tradition for families all over the city.

The Oklahoma City Ballet has been pirouetting and jeté-ing their way into the hearts of Oklahomans for over 40 years. With a repertoire that ranges from traditional classics like The Nutcracker and Swan Lake to contemporary works by renowned choreographers, there’s something for everyone to enjoy. And with their state-of-the-art dance facility, the Susan E. Brackett Dance Center, the OKC Ballet is able to offer top-notch training for aspiring dancers as well.
